    Washington Vs Zombies - Jump or Fall

    Hello Everybody!

    It's a big pleasure for me and our studio, Jump or Fall, to discover this community!
    Yesterday our free indie game "Washington Vs Zombies" got published on OUYA store and we're very excited about it ^v^

    WvsZ started from a humorous prototype of President Washington fighting zombies and then we ended up making a full game out of it. It’s a sidescroller action game where you play as Washington (surpriiiise) and you shoot and slash zombies (and ghost zombies ) with various swords, handguns and rifles which can be bought using coins collected in game.
